Career path
| Career Role (Primary Keyword: Support; Secondary Keyword: Asylum) | Description |
|---|---|
| Asylum Caseworker (Support Worker) | Providing comprehensive support and advocacy for asylum seekers navigating the complex UK asylum system. |
| Immigration Solicitor (Legal Support) | Offering legal representation and advice to asylum seekers, ensuring their rights are protected throughout the process. Expertise in immigration law is crucial. |
| Interpreter/Translator (Language Support) | Facilitating communication between asylum seekers and service providers, bridging language barriers for effective support. |
| Community Outreach Worker (Asylum Support) | Connecting asylum seekers with essential services and resources within their communities, fostering integration and well-being. |
| Mental Health Support Worker (Asylum Seeker Support) | Providing crucial mental health support and counselling to asylum seekers dealing with trauma and the stresses of seeking refuge. |
